fēng(Feng1)

酆 (fēng) primarily refers to a historical state from the Zhou Dynasty and can also denote its capital city. Additionally, it serves as a surname in modern contexts. This character is typically encountered in historical texts or discussions about ancient Chinese states and dynasties.

Usage Notes

酆 is rarely used in contemporary conversation, so it typically appears in formal or academic contexts. Learners should be cautious not to confuse it with phonetic similarities to other characters like 风 (fēng, wind). Be aware that its usage as a surname can lead to some confusion in discussions about family names.
